Historically, the most infamous and direct cause of Monster Hunter Rise save data corruption is linked to two specific DLC pose sets: the "Attack Pose Set" and the "Hurt Pose Set." Capcom issued an official statement warning players that if these two pose sets were equipped on the or the radial menu before quitting the game, it could corrupt the save data, making it inaccessible upon restarting. A subsequent patch was released to fix this issue, but it illustrates how specific in-game actions can lead to global save problems. Monster Hunter Rise -0100B04011742800--v2228224...
